Transaction 1feef900e14d471ad67a1c6f9b386758dcc60e942ae55171353a2209326d64f8
1 Input
1 Output
-
1feef900e14d471ad67a1c6f9b386758dcc60e942ae55171353a2209326d64f8:0
- value
- 308414048
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1bc9267b73baca5cb0ca4d38a2917a2c89a1033
- address
- bc1qux7fyeah8wk2tjcv5nfc52gh5tyf5ypnu9xq4f